How This Trade Impacts Cleveland Cavaliers

The Cleveland Cavaliers have to decide if they want Collin Sexton as part of their long-term plan. If not, trading him is the route they should take so that they can at least get something of value back for him.

If they were able to get this trade package from the Knicks, they would jump at the opportunity. Given the fact that Sexton is still on his rookie deal, matching salaries and getting fair value back isn’t easy. Unless the Cavaliers wanted to expand the deal to include someone such as Kevin Love.

In this scenario, they hit a home run. Immanuel Quickley has immense two-way potential and his ceiling is even higher if he can demonstrate the ability to play point guard at a high level. He is already an excellent source of scoring and defense with the second unit.

The Kentucky product could slide into the starting lineup alongside Darius Garland in Cleveland. The first-round pick in 2023 is a nice asset for the Cleveland Cavaliers to extract from New York as well. They would be getting two building blocks for their foundation by moving Sexton in this deal and save a lot of money as they wouldn’t be handing him an extension.

Taj Gibson is an excellent veteran that would provide mentorship for all of the young big men on the roster. Jarrett Allen, Evan Mobley, and Lauri Markkanen would all benefit from the tutelage Gibson would bestow upon them.

To receive this much in a package for a player the team doesn’t seem to have much interest in keeping long-term would be a win for the organization.
